实现MySQL转换时间函数转成xxx年xx月xx日格式

作为一名经验丰富的开发者,我很乐意教会刚入行的小白如何实现将MySQL转换时间函数转成xxx年xx月xx日格式。下面是整个过程的步骤:

步骤 操作
步骤一 定义日期时间字段
步骤二 使用MySQL的DATE_FORMAT函数转换
步骤三 将转换后的时间字段作为变量
步骤四 将变量按照指定格式输出

现在,让我们一步一步来实现这个功能。

步骤一:定义日期时间字段

首先,你需要确保你的数据库表中有一个日期时间字段,我们可以将其命名为date_time。这个字段将会存储你需要转换的时间。

步骤二:使用MySQL的DATE_FORMAT函数转换

接下来,我们可以使用MySQL的DATE_FORMAT函数将日期时间字段转换成我们想要的格式。这个函数接受两个参数:日期时间字段和格式字符串。格式字符串可以根据你的需求进行自定义,例如"%Y年%m月%d日"表示以年、月、日的格式输出。

下面是使用DATE_FORMAT函数的代码示例:

SELECT DATE_FORMAT(date_time, '%Y年%m月%d日') AS formatted_date FROM your_table;

这条SQL语句将会把date_time字段按照"%Y年%m月%d日"的格式输出,并将结果赋值给一个名为formatted_date的字段。

步骤三:将转换后的时间字段作为变量

如果你想在代码中使用转换后的时间字段,你可以将其作为一个变量保存起来。在MySQL中,你可以使用SELECT INTO语句来实现。

下面是保存转换后的时间字段为变量的代码示例:

SELECT DATE_FORMAT(date_time, '%Y年%m月%d日') INTO @formatted_date FROM your_table;

这条SQL语句将会把date_time字段按照"%Y年%m月%d日"的格式转换,并将结果保存到一个名为@formatted_date的变量中。

步骤四:将变量按照指定格式输出

最后,如果你想在MySQL中直接输出变量,你可以使用SELECT语句。

下面是将变量按照指定格式输出的代码示例:

SELECT @formatted_date;

这条SQL语句将会输出保存在@formatted_date变量中的结果。

接下来,让我们通过甘特图来更直观地展示整个过程的时间安排。

gantt
    dateFormat  YYYY-MM-DD
    title MySQL转换时间函数转成xxx年xx月xx日格式

    section 定义日期时间字段
    步骤一           : 2022-01-01, 1d

    section 使用MySQL的DATE_FORMAT函数转换
    步骤二           : 2022-01-02, 1d

    section 将转换后的时间字段作为变量
    步骤三           : 2022-01-03, 1d

    section 将变量按照指定格式输出
    步骤四           : 2022-01-04, 1d

以上就是实现MySQL转换时间函数转成xxx年xx月xx日格式的完整流程。希望对你有所帮助!如果有任何问题,请随时向我提问。